Thanks for the reply..!!
My actual prb is i have a requirement to use the service ProductActivityNotification_In( SAP SNC enterprise service) which is present under the namespace http://sap.com/xi/APO/Global. But i am not sure, where is this namespace located( under which scv).??If that is known, i can import that particular scv from sld and make use of the enterprise service under the above mentioned namespace.
Hope u got my point!
Hi,
I hope i just replied you in one of the other forum. Its a part of SAP SCM Basis 7.0. It is a standard package, so if you are not able to see this in ESR, you should ask your basis team to download the XI content and install it in ESR. You won't be able to import it from SLD.

First of all, in SLD you cant see namespce as its something which you create in ESR/IR only after creating a SWC in SLD. So as such there is no link to namespace from SLD.
Secondly, you first need to check with your BASIS/Admin team if they have downloaded the pre delievered content from service marketplace. If they did then, you can look for documentation of this scenario in service marketplace only. It will give u details about the namespeace, interfaces and services.
